The Evolution of Canada’s Online Casino Market: An Industry Overview
Over the past decade, the online casino sector in Canada has transitioned from a loosely regulated niche to a highly scrutinised and immensely competitive industry. Provincial regulators now oversee distinct markets, with jurisdictions like Ontario leading the charge through comprehensive licensing frameworks introduced in 2022 that align with international standards.

Key Regulatory Developments Shaping 2024
The legalization wave has established clear standards, including mandatory player protections, responsible gaming protocols, and secure payment systems. Noteworthy highlights include:
- Ontario iGaming Market Expansion: Launched in April 2022 and now comprising more than 35 licensed operators, Ontario’s framework serves as a model for rigorous regulation and market innovation.
- Federated Regulatory Collaborations: Ongoing efforts between provincial bodies aim to harmonize standards, fostering cross-border cooperation and data sharing.
- Emergence of a Centralized Licensing System: Anticipated adoption of unified licensing in other provinces to create a cohesive national market.
Technological Innovations Driving Industry Growth
2024 is set to witness the integration of advanced technologies, elevating the player experience and maintaining fairness:
| Technology | Impact | Industry Example |
|---|---|---|
| Artificial Intelligence (AI) | Enhances personalised gaming, responsible gambling alerts, and fraud detection. | Popular sites leverage AI-driven chatbots for customer support. |
| Blockchain | Increases transparency with provably fair mechanisms and secure payments. | Some operators now offer cryptocurrency options. |
| Virtual Reality (VR) | Creates immersive gaming environments for an authentic casino experience from home. | Emerging VR casino rooms attract tech-savvy players. |
